抄録

<p>For photosynthesis promotion in the field of agriculture, we report on solution-processed molecular alignment control of organic fluorescent dye using guest-host effect and photo-polymerization reaction in this paper. We investigated the relation between molecular conformation and polarized photoluminescence characteristics in dye/polymer blend films. As the result, we observed polarized photoluminescence with reduction of concentration quenching effect and disordered region of dye molecules. We discussed the solution process and materials for highly-ordered solid-state films using liquid crystalline monomer and fluorescent dye.</p>
